APN Proxy issue

There is a proxy server on my Wi-Fi network, my device is not be able to use APNs.


Is there a solution or workaround for this issue as I cannot bypass the proxy server?

iPad, iOS 6.1.2

It sounds like you are not receiving push notifications due to a proxy setup on your Wi-Fi network. The following provides more information:


Devices using APNs need a direct connection to Apple's server. If a device is unable to connect using cellular data, it will attempt to use Wi-Fi if available. If there is a proxy server on the Wi-Fi network, the device will not be able to use APNs, because APNs requires a direct and persistent connection from device to server.


Unable to use Apple Push Notification service (APNs)
